� DATE: October 7, 1986
TO: Honorable Chairman and members of the Board of Directors
FROM: Donald J. Fraser, Acting Assistant City Manager
BY: Deborah Coulter, Acting Administrative Analyst III
SUBJECT: City Newsletter
PURPOSE
To have the Board of Directors authorize staff to solicit bids for the
typesetting and printing of the City Newsletter.
BACKGROUND
At the meeting of September 3, 1985, the Board authorized staff to use
the services of Del Amo Press for the printing and typesetting of the
city newsletter "Lynwood Living" on a trial basis for one year. Since
then Del Amo Press has printed four issues of the newsletter in the
: expanded eight page magazine format with an average cost of three
thousand four hundred dollars ($3,400) per issue.
` In order to ensure the production of a quality newsletter at
' competitive costs, staff has prepared a bid solicitation package for
the printing and typesetting of the newsletter. The bid
specifications will require the contractor to produce four issues of
' "Lynwood Living" on a winter, spring, summer, fall schedule. It will
also require the same eight page maqazine format as is currently used.
� RECOMMENDATION
It is recommended that the Board authorize staff to solicit bids for
' the typesetting and printinq of the city newsletter according to the
attached bid specifications.

, INSTRUCTIONS TO BIDDERS
PUBLICATION OF CITY NEWSLETTER
LYNWOOD, CALIFORNIA, 90262
These instructions, together with a contract to be drawn up which
shall incorporate' the bid specifications shall constitute the terms
and conditions of the Agreement between the successful bidder and
Lynwood Information, Inc.
1. A11 bids must be fully completed on the forms attached hereto
and returned intact with the full document.
2. All bids must be signed, sealed in an envelope and addressed to
the City Clerk, 11330 Bullis Road, Lynwood, California, 90262.
The outside of the envelope shall plainly bear the name of the
bidder, his address, and "BID FOR CITY NEWSL&TTER."
Blank spaces in the proposal must be properly filled in, using
ink, indelible pencil, or typewriter, and the phraseology of the
proposal must not be changed. Any unauthorized conditions,
lirnitations or proviso attached to a proposal will be liable to'
render it informal and may cause rejection. Bidders are invited
to be present at the opening of proposals.
3. If any information already entered by the bidder on the Bid Form
is to be modified, it shall be crossed out with ink, the amended
information entered above or below, and initialed in ink by the
bidder.
4. The Corporation shall not permit any bid to be modified once the
sealed bid has been publicly opened by the'Cbrporation at the bid
openinq. No responsibility shall attach to a Corporation employee
for the premature opening of a bid not properly addressed and
identified in accordance with the bid documents.
5. Any bid may be withdrawn prior to the specified date and time for
the openinq of bids.
6. Any bid received after the time and date specified shall not be
considered and will be returned unopened.
7. Explanations desired by a prospective bidder shall be requested of
the Corporation in writing. No inquires received less than twenty
(20) days prior to the date specified for submission and bid
opening will be given consideration. Any verbal statements or
explanations by any person, previous to the award of Contract,
shall be unathoritative and not binding. Any and all explanations
and any supplemental instructions will be in the form of written
addenda mailed by certified mail, return receipt requested, to all
�, prospective bidders not later than ten (10) days prior to the date
fixed for the opening of bids.
( 8. The Contract: The bidder to whom the award is made will be issued
I a Purchase Order by the Corporation or enter into a written
I contract with Lynwood Information, Inc. In case of default by the
vendor, the Corporation reserves the right to procure the services
( from other sources and to hold the vendor responsible for any
excess cost incurred by the Corporation thereby. The contract to
i be entered into will be written after award of the bid and will
I incorporate the enclosed bid specifications.
�
I 9. Errors and Omissions: The vendor shall not be allowed to take
advantage of any errors and/or omissions in these specifications
� or in the.vendor's specifications submitted with his proposal.
� Full instructions will always be given when such errors or
I omissions are discovered.
i
I
I - .
� �
��� 10. Default:
a. If the vendor fails in any manner to fully perform and carry
out each and all of the terms, covenants, and conditions of the
contract the vendor shall be in default and notice in writing
shall be given the vendor of such default. The Corporation,
acting by and through the Purchasing Officer, may at its option
terminate and cancel the contract, and at the expense of the
vendor complete the contract or cause the same to be completed.
b. Such termination shall not affect or terminate any of the
rights of the City as against the vendor then existing, or which
may thereafter accrue because of such default and the foregoinq
provision shall be in addition to all other rights and remedies
available to the Corporation under the law.
c. - The waiver or breach of any term, covenant or condition
hereof shall not operate as a waiver of any subsequent breech of
the same or any other term, covenant, or condition hereof.
11. The vendor will not be held liable for failure or delay in
fulfillment if hindered or prevented by fire, strikes, or Acts of
God.
12. The preceding Instructions and Conditions and the Attached are
applicable to this Bid and the BIDDER ACKNOWLEDGES ACCEPTANCE
THEROF BY SIGNING AND FILING SAID BID.
13. The basis for award of the Hid shall be the lowest per issue price -
bid from a responsive and responsible bidder. The evaluation of
bids and the determination of conformity and acceptability shall
be the sole responsibility of the Corporation and will be based on
information furnished by the bidder, or identified in his bid, as
' well as other information reasonably available to the Corporation.

� • OOD INFORMATION, INC. •
SPECIFICATIONS '
I. General
A. The newsletter will be issued four (4) times a year:
the usual pattern will be a fall, winter, spring and
summer editions.
B. The bidder shall provide services beginning with the
paste-up and shall continue through delivery of the
finished product. A rough draft must be submitted and
approved by the city before printing.
C. Bidder shall deliver fifteen thousand two hundred
' (15,200) copies of the completed newsletter within one month
after the articles and pictures are submitted by the
city.
-14,000 copies delivered to West Coast Mailers 5630
Borwick, South Gate CA.
-1,200 copies delivered to City of Lynwood, 11330
- Bullis Road, Lynwood CA. 90262
II. Specifications
A. Each issue shall be an eight page self-cover booklet with
g 1/2" x 11" page size, to be printed on 60# white gloss
coated paper.
B. Each issue shall be bound by use of saddle stitch in two
places.
C. Each issue shall be printed in three colors.
' . D, Pictures per issue will not exceed seven; there may be
some diagrams and/or maps. Some artwork may be required.
C
I III. Description
1
j One to two pages of the newsletter will be devoted to the
� recreation program with the remaininq portion to
, consist of news articles, pictures and/or maps.
